Baha'i Prayer Beads

 

The Inspiration: 

 

"It hath been ordained that every believer in God, the Lord of Judgment, shall, each day, having washed his hands and then his face, seat himself and, turning unto God, repeat `Allah-u-Abha' ninety-five times.

Such was the decree of the Maker of the Heavens when, with majesty and power, He established Himself upon the thrones of His Names." (KITÁB-I-AQDAS)

 

About the Beads:

 

These beads (19+5) were lovingly created by Alan, for this their intended purpose; To help you to keep count of the 95 times you repeat `Allah-u-Abha'. (As 19 x 5 = 95)

Created using Imported Italian Glass, utilizing an age-old wound glass technique. The beads were then properly Kiln Annealed for long lasting durability!

 

About the Finished Construction:

 

The beads were then lovingly strung by Alan into the Prayer Bead arrangement that you see pictured here, utilizing waxed Belfast linen. 

The tassel also created by Alan, was put together using Antique Silk Floss.
